Powerbank Module intended for use with Arduino, Raspberry, and other development boards, allowing the connection of up to 2 18650 cells in PARALLEL. It features output voltages of 3V and 5V, making it compatible with most development boards.

The 3V and 5V connections are made through expansion pins spaced at 2.54mm. For each output, there are 5 outputs of this type. A USB Female output is also added, allowing the charging of electronics or powering programming boards via USB cable.

The module includes a battery charging control IC with protection against overvoltage, overcurrent, short circuit, and charging timeout. Charging is done through one of the dedicated ports, MicroUSB or USB Type-C.

The module supports up to 2 cells in parallel (fewer can be used, minimum one cell) to increase the total capacity. Before connecting the cells in parallel, make sure they are at the same charge level! If you connect a charged battery and a discharged one, they will overheat and likely be damaged because the cells will try to equalize between them at a fairly high current.

The module has a series of LEDs indicating the battery charge level. During charging, the LED corresponding to the charge level will blink.

 

Usage:

On the side, there is a button for ON/OFF. Once the 18650 cells are connected, pressing the button is necessary to turn on the module. A long press of the side ON/OFF button turns off the module. This also means that when the batteries are removed from the module, it automatically enters the OFF state and the ON/OFF button must be pressed again to restart the module. When charging, pressing the button is not necessary.

The HOLD function is not guaranteed on this module. For HOLD, the module uses a resistor marked 62 to maintain a consumer always active and thus prevent entering Sleep mode. It is possible that this resistor does not provide the minimum current needed to prevent Sleep mode. If HOLD mode is desired, the resistor must be replaced with a smaller one to increase the current.

 

Important:

- There is no polarity protection! Reversing + with - will burn the IC.

- Removing the cells without turning off the module beforehand may trigger the safety shutdown function. To use the module again, it is necessary to connect it for charging.

- Respect the polarity! With 18650 cells, it is easy to insert the batteries incorrectly. Observe the + and - signs. If the polarity is not respected, the IC will burn!

 

Specifications:

Power supply voltage: 5VDC (5 - 8VDC supported)

Charging port: Micro USB and Type C

Charging current: 2.5A

Output voltage: 5VDC and 3VDC (actual 5.3V and 3.3V)

5V output current: 2A

3V output current: 1A

Conversion efficiency: 95%

USB Female output: 5VDC, to be used with USB cable

3V output: 5 outputs

5V output: 5 outputs

3V and 5V expansion output: Pins

Pin spacing: 2.54mm

Standby current: 3uA

Battery voltage range: 3.2 - 4.2VDC

Battery alarm voltage: 3V

Short-circuit protection: Yes

Overcurrent protection: Yes

Polarity protection: NO

Compatible batteries: 18650

Connection mode: Parallel

Number of slots: 2

Dimensions mm: 100 x 60 x 21mm
